@charset "UTF-8";

.select-car-list {
 width: 840px; 
}

.select-car-detail {
  display: flex;
  flex-wrap: wrap;
  width: 840px;
  gap: 20px;
}

@media screen and (max-width:1180px) {
  .select-car-detail {
    width: 100% !important;
  }
}

.select-car-name-init {
  margin-bottom: 47px;
  display: -webkit-box;
  display: -ms-flexbox;
  display: flex;
  -webkit-box-pack: center;
  -ms-flex-pack: center;
  justify-content: center;
}

@media (max-width: 1020px) {
  .select-car-name-init {
    width: 100%;
    overflow: scroll;
    margin-bottom: 65px;
  }
}

@media screen and (max-width: 480px) {
  .select-car-name-init {
    -webkit-box-pack: start;
    -ms-flex-pack: start;
    justify-content: flex-start;
  }
}

.select-car-name-init button.tab {
  color: var(--clr-black);
  font-size: 16px;
  font-weight: 700;
  line-height: 150%;
  padding: 0 10px;
  border-left: 1px solid var(--clr-black);
}

@media (max-width: 1020px) {
  .select-car-name-init button.tab {
    white-space: nowrap;
  }
}

.select-car-name-init button.tab:last-child {
  border-right: 1px solid var(--clr-black);
}

.select-car-name-init button.tab.-active, .select-car-name-init button.tab:hover {
  color: var(--clr-prime);
  text-decoration: underline;
}

.select-car-name-init button.tab.-empty {
  color: var(--clr-gray-light);
  pointer-events: none;
}

.select-car-name-init li {
  padding: 0 10px;
  border-left: 1px solid var(--clr-black);
}

.select-car-name-init li:last-child {
  border-right: 1px solid var(--clr-black);
}

.select-car-name-init-btn {
  color: var(--clr-black);
  font-size: 16px;
  font-weight: 700;
  line-height: 150%;
}

@media (max-width: 1020px) {
  .select-car-name-init-btn {
    white-space: nowrap;
  }
}

.select-car-name-init-btn.is-active, .select-car-name-init-btn:hover {
  color: var(--clr-prime);
  text-decoration: underline;
}

.select-car-name-init-btn.-empty {
  color: var(--clr-gray-light);
  pointer-events: none;
}

.select-car-name-btns {
  display: -webkit-box;
  display: -ms-flexbox;
  display: flex;
  -ms-flex-wrap: wrap;
  flex-wrap: wrap;
  gap: 20px 10px;
}

.arrowbox{
	font-size:12px;
	position: absolute;
	z-index:1000;
	background:#000000;
	border:4px solid #000000;
	color:#fff;
	border-radius:4px;
	width:auto;
	margin:0 auto 10px;
	padding:6px;
	top: calc(100% - 160px);
	opacity:0.8;
}
.arrow_box:before,.arrowbox:after{
	top:100%;
	left:50%;
	border:solid transparent;
	content:" ";
	height:0;
	width:0;position:absolute;
	pointer-events:none
}
.arrowbox:after{
	border-color:rgba(6,49,86,0);
	border-top-color:#063156;
	border-width:10px;
	margin-left:-10px
}
.arrowbox:before{
	border-color:rgba(6,49,86,0);
	border-top-color:#063156;
	border-width:16px;
	margin-left:-16px
}

.-relative {
  position: relative;
}

.-car-select_new {
  width: 410px !important;
}

@media screen and (max-width:1180px) {
  .-car-select_new {
    width: 100% !important;
  }
}

.mycar-with-not-top-page-btn {
  width: 100%;
  padding: 15px 10px;
  border-color: var(--clr-second);
  background-color: var(--clr-second);
  display: -webkit-box;
  display: -ms-flexbox;
  display: flex;
  position: relative;
  margin: 0 auto;
  position: fixed;
    z-index: 99;
}

.common-background-color {
  background-color: rgba(0, 0, 0, 0.8);
}

.-display-none {
  display: none;
}

